Integrating targeted approaches in online therapy

Internal Family Systems (IFS) views the mind as composed of distinct parts and helps clients notice, understand, and compassionately relate to those internal voices; it is often used to explore trauma responses, inner conflict, and patterns that affect self-worth. Attachment-Based Therapy focuses on how early relationship experiences shape current ways of connecting and relying on others, assisting clients who struggle with trust, abandonment worries, or relational patterns. Client-Centered Therapy emphasizes empathic listening, acceptance, and creating a supportive environment where people can explore their goals and build confidence.

Finding the right approach is part of the therapeutic process, and the therapist collaborates with each person to determine which methods best match their needs, goals, and preferences. Sessions may combine elements from different models to address immediate coping skills while also working on deeper patterns.
